3.2 LUBRICATION GUIDE
Refer to Figure 3-1 for location of fluid fill port. For best 
value and longest uninterrupted service, the 3700 Series 
compressors are factory filled and tested with Sullube 
lubricant.
If fluid change is required, follow Lubrication Change 
Recommendations, Section 3.4.
Maintenance of all other components is still 
recommended as indicated in the Operator’s Manual.
DO NOT MIX DIFFERENT TYPES OF FLUIDS. 
Contamination of non-detergent mineral fluids with 
traces of detergent motor fluids may lead to operational 
problems such as foaming, filter plugging, orifice or line 
plugging.
When ambient conditions exceed those noted or if 
conditions warrant use of “extended” life lubricants 
contact Sullair for recommendation.

3.3 APPLICATION GUIDE
Sullair encourages the user to participate in a fluid 
analysis program with the fluid suppliers. This could 
result in a fluid change interval differing from that stated 
in the manual. Contact your Sullair dealer for details.
CAUTION
Mixing of other lubricants within the 
compressor unit will void all warranties.

A WARNINGA WARNINGA WARNING
"The Plastic Pipe Institute recommends 
against the use of thermoplastic pipe to 
transport compressed air or other 
compressed gases in exposed above 
ground locations, e.g. in exposed plant 
piping." (I)
Sullube should not be used with PVC 
piping systems. It may affect the bond at 
cemented joints. Certain other plastic 
materials may also be affected.
(I) Plastic Pipe Institute, Recommendation 
B, Adopted January 19, 1972.
